VERANDAH REACHES 50 PERCENT SOLD OUT MARK

FORT MYERS, Fla. (May 15, 2008) – Verandah, the 1,456-acre community being developed by Bonita Bay Group along a 1.75-mile stretch of the Orange River in Fort Myers, recently sold its 835th home, pushing Verandah’s total to the halfway mark since the community opened for sales in February 2003.
Verandah was designed in harmony with the existing landscape. Bonita Bay Group, which acquired the property in 1999, spent years working and reworking the community’s site plan to fit around existing trees. It spent hundreds of hours weaving neighborhoods, infrastructure and amenities into the site to impact as few trees as possible. Those that were ultimately affected were relocated – a process that took a year. The company also restored a flow way that had been impacted by prior agricultural use, required all single-family model homes be built as green homes and was named Florida’s first Green Development.
Verandah now serves as a role model for green development – reiterated by several state and national environmental awards. The community has received the Florida Association of Realtor’s 2006 Environmental (ENVY) Award; the Council for Sustainable Florida’s 2007 Best Practices Award for green building, the Florida Urban Forestry Council’s Trees Florida 2007 Award, and Project EverGreen’s Because Green Matters Award.
Verandah has also been named by Where to Retire magazine as one of “America’s 100 Best Master-Planned Communities” in 2007 and was named Community of the Year by the Lee Building Industry Association in 2005 and 2008. The Jack Nicklaus and Jack Nicklaus II co-designed Whispering Oak golf course, which opened in January 2007, was named by Golf Inc. magazine as one of the top five new private courses in the country in 2007.
The Orange River and moss-draped oak trees have become Verandah’s trademark, as has its southern style of architecture, which gives a nod to Old Florida. “We could have gone anywhere but we really wanted a sense of Old Florida,” said Penny. “Golfing was very important to us and so was nature and being surrounded by green. We were also happy about River Village because we didn’t want a big clubhouse.”
River Village, Verandah’s amenities center, was designed to fit within a riverfront hammock of live oaks. Individual buildings – the Golf House pro shop, Boat House, a Tennis and Fitness Center, and the River House restaurant and lounge – limited the impact on the trees. The village also has a community tree house and Oak Park. Last year, the newest community amenity made its debut when Dog Park opened.

Visionary Award as seen in Gulfshore Life

Bonita Bay Group’s Verandah community was named a top five finalist for the 2008 Visionary Award presented by Sustainable Land Development International. The announcement was made during the annual Land Development Breakthroughs conference earlier this month in Austin, Texas. Verandah was the only community in Florida in contention for the honor, which was presented to a community in Colorado. The conference and awards program are designed to promote and recognize sustainable development and improve the land development industry.
